Why It Matters

The current landscape of AI integration into the workforce is not merely a trend; it represents a seismic shift in how productivity is defined and achieved. The narrative surrounding AI and job displacement has often been dominated by fears of an impending apocalypse, yet the reality is starkly different.

" Instead, AI is enabling a new breed of talent—what can be termed 'AI-pill' individuals—who are capable of exponentially increasing their output. This shift is particularly pertinent for marketers, as the tools and capabilities afforded by AI can lead to more effective strategies and campaigns.

For instance, the ability to automate mundane tasks allows marketers to focus on creativity and strategic thinking. Furthermore, the demand for services that assist businesses in implementing AI solutions is on the rise, indicating a growing market for AI-driven innovations. As one expert aptly puts it, "If you have AI pill engineers, they're doing more ultimately...

" This underscores the necessity for marketers to adapt and embrace AI tools to enhance their efficiency and effectiveness. The implications of these changes are profound, as companies that leverage AI effectively will not only survive but thrive in an increasingly competitive landscape. Frequently Asked Questions

What strategies did the one-person AI company use to achieve $401M in revenue?
The one-person AI company leveraged advanced AI tools to automate tasks, streamline operations, and enhance productivity. By focusing on efficiency and innovation, the founder was able to deliver high-quality products and services without the need for a large team.
How can marketers benefit from the rise of AI in their industry?
Marketers can benefit from AI by utilizing tools that automate repetitive tasks, analyze data for insights, and personalize customer interactions. This allows them to focus on strategic planning and creative aspects of their campaigns, ultimately leading to more effective marketing efforts.
What are the risks associated with increased productivity through AI?
While AI can significantly boost productivity, it also poses risks such as employee burnout and the potential for job displacement in certain sectors. Companies must prioritize employee well-being and provide support to ensure that their teams can adapt to the demands of an AI-driven environment.
What does the future hold for marketing in an AI-dominated landscape?
The future of marketing will likely see an increase in AI integration, leading to more personalized and targeted campaigns. As AI technologies continue to evolve, marketers will need to stay informed and adapt their strategies to leverage these advancements effectively.
How is AI changing the job market for marketers?
AI is transforming the job market for marketers by creating new roles focused on data analysis, AI implementation, and strategic planning. While some traditional roles may decline, new opportunities will emerge as companies seek individuals who can navigate the complexities of AI-driven marketing.
What are 'AI-pill' individuals, and why are they important?
'AI-pill' individuals are professionals who leverage AI tools to enhance their productivity and efficiency. They are important because they exemplify the potential of AI to empower individuals to achieve more, fundamentally changing how work is approached in various industries.
